SUBJECT: DJIBOUTI NEC SITE - REQUEST FOR OBO ASSISTANCE 
 
REF: (A) STATE 092993,  (B) STATE 091268,  (C) DJIBOUTI 483 
 
1. (U) Post acknowledges receipt of funding (Ref A) and is 
pleased at the overall progress towards closing on the 
Salines South site.  Much has been accomplished in the 
brief time allotted, and with the successful resolution of 
a few remaining technical points regarding zoning, 
construction timeline and geotechnical studies, we believe 
that the final sales agreement can be signed in June, 
commensurate with the visit of the OBO team from Eihorn 
Yaffee Prescott. 
 
2. (U) To that end, it is Post's considered opinion that 
the final negotiations and resolution of remaining 
geotechnical points will be greatly enhanced by the 
presence of real estate and technical experts to lend 
assistance.  Post requests that REPM/AQD Vicki Hartung 
travel to Djibouti to assist with negotiating the final 
settlement.   In addition, Post believes it would be very 
useful if PE/DE/ABF T. Skep Nordmark could accompany the 
team to resolve any last minute geotechnical issues.
